113th Congress Passes Legislation to Develop Feasibility Plan for the Creation of a National Women's History Museum

It took 15 years, but the National Women's History Museum (NWHM), a 501 (c)(3) organization founded in 1996, has finally scored a victory in its effort to build a world-class museum on the National Mall. NWHM is dedicated to "preserving, interpreting and celebrating the diverse historic contributions of women, and integrating this rich heritage fully into our nation's history." AWIS is part of a 51-member coalition of national organizations that support the NWHM's mission. This past summer, we participated in a letter writing campaign urging U.S. Senators to pass this legislation that will enable congress to appoint an eight-member panel that will have 18 months to produce a congressional report outlining how the museum can be created and maintained. The legislation was co-sponsored by Senator Susan Collins (R-ME), Representative Carolyn Maloney (D-NY), Senator Barbara Mikulski (D-MD) and Representative Marsha Blackburn (R-TN). Now it is ready for President Obama's signature.
